Other Ingredients (4)

Magnesium StearateLubricant

A salt of stearic acid used as a lubricant in tablet and capsule production

Silicon DioxideAnti-caking

Fine silica powder used to prevent clumping

HypromelloseCapsule

Plant-derived capsule material from cellulose

Microcrystalline CelluloseBinder

Plant-derived cellulose used as a binder and filler in supplements

How to Take It

Best taken in the evening

Often taken in the evening for sleep and cortisol; take with food to avoid stomach upset.

With food
Space it a couple of hours from Iron and Calcium
Label directs 2 servings — keep one for the evening

On the label

Take two capsules twice per day or as directed by your healthcare practitioner.

General guidance based on the ingredients, not a substitute for the label or your doctor.

Sources & Scoring

Nutrient data (RDA, UL, and safety thresholds) sourced from: NIH Office of Dietary Supplements and National Academies Dietary Reference Intakes (DRI).

This is not medical advice. Consult a healthcare provider before making changes to your supplement routine.

The score analyzes what's on the label: ingredient doses vs. studied ranges, chemical forms, evidence levels, and known interactions. It does not verify label accuracy or test for contaminants — for that, look for third-party certifications like USP or NSF.
